ABOUT | A
website dedicated to the history of Summerhill Road Tottenham that
includes memories and photographs from residents both past and present. The website has since developed into a Local History for Tottenham in general and includes many fascinating history snippets and further historic photographs and social history from Tottenham's past. |

WW1 - WEST GREEN MEMORIAL - UPDATE NOVEMBER 2022 |
************************************************************ We are pleased to announce that the annual Remembrance Day service at the West Green Memorial will take place on Sunday 10th November 2024, commencing at 2:30 pm , The ceremony will once again be hosted by Cllr Barbara Blake, on behalf of Haringey Council, together with contributions from other invited guests including the Minister from the nearby Seventh Day Adventist Church. There will also be marching bands and displays from local youth groups . This will be followed by a short history of the Memorial and some facts about the men who are commemorated there. We have also turned to social media and open invitations for the public to attend were posted in four of the main Local History pages on Facebook.
